- 博客(5)
- 收藏
- 关注
原创 QDockWidget 透明问题记录--bug解决篇
当我们将QDockWidget设置float 同时合并/或者GroupedDragging模式下合并在拖出来此时QDockWidget的父窗口为变为QDockWidgetGroupWindow窗口类,同时QDockWidgetGroupWindow内有有一个QTabBar对所有的QDockWidget管理,遍历QDockWidgetGroupWindow下的QTabBar判断是否维护了多个QDockWidget,如果只维护了一个就拦截accept,否则放行事件ignore();
2024-06-30 19:22:16
180
原创 qt qdockwidget 透明问题记录
但是当我们当我们的QMainWindow设置为GroupedDrading时候 ,在2个QDockWidget都为docked状态时合并,同时拖出来后发现窗户还是不透明。原因是弹出的窗口合并后会有一个QDockWidgetGroupWindow类窗口管理,因此我们需要设置QDockWidgetGroupWindow的窗口属性,当QDockWidget使用自定义头时,存在崩溃,具体描述如下:当我们将窗户合并后拖拽出来,如下图。将所有子窗口都设置透明属性,虽然能达到效果,但是这样会影响其他子窗口,效果如下。
2024-06-30 12:25:30
280
原创 electron ffi调用C++ dll 依赖
记录一个S,B问题,windowss electron ffi 调用 C++ dll 依赖问题,运行目录在 modules/electron/dist需要将dll的依赖拷贝下去 不然 126错误 你懂滴 !暴力方法:varkernel32=ffi.Library("kernel32",{'SetDllDirectoryA':["bool",["string"]]})kernel32.SetDllDirectoryA("路径");...
2021-01-24 04:45:13
263
5
原创 汇编
寄存器:AX BX CX DX DI SI BP SP堆分配:由起始地址开始,从低位向高位增长栈分配:由结束地址开始,从高位到低位 ,(先分配的在高位 后分配的在低位) 大端: 高低低高小端:低低高高...
2018-03-23 12:50:42
130
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人